Norway Construction Market Overview
Norway's residential construction market is currently contracting, with housing starts of 21K in 2023 — 31% below the 10-year average of 31K.
The country's recorded peak was 38K units in 2016. Current activity is -44% below that peak.
Among the 21 OECD countries tracked, Norway ranks #19 by total housing starts. Year-over-year change is -27.6%, reflecting declining permits and reduced construction activity.
